Understanding Basement Floor Cracks: Normal vs. Problematic

Not all basement floor cracks are created equal. Learning to distinguish between typical settling cracks and those indicating foundation problems is the first step in proper assessment:

Normal Concrete Cracks

Some cracking is expected in concrete basement floors:

  • Hairline cracks: Extremely thin, shallow cracks smaller than 1/16 inch wide
  • Shrinkage cracks: Typically appear within the first year as the concrete cures
  • Surface crazing: Network of fine, shallow cracks resembling a spider web
  • Control joint cracks: Occur along intentionally weakened lines designed to control cracking
  • Isolated cracks: Single cracks not connected to wall cracks or other floor cracks

Warning Sign Cracks

Several types of cracks indicate potential foundation problems:

  • Wide cracks: Openings wider than 1/8 inch suggest significant movement
  • Uneven cracks: Where one side is higher than the other (vertical displacement)
  • Cracks with moisture: Consistently moist cracks indicate water intrusion
  • Multiple parallel cracks: Several cracks running in the same direction
  • Cracks extending into walls: Floor cracks that continue up foundation walls

Common Types of Basement Floor Cracks and Their Causes

Different crack patterns provide clues about their underlying causes:

1. Hairline Shrinkage Cracks

These common cracks result from the concrete curing process:

  • Appearance: Very thin, shallow, often in random patterns
  • Cause: Natural shrinkage as concrete dries and cures
  • Concern level: Low, typically cosmetic only
  • Progression: Usually stabilizes after the first year
  • Water risk: Minimal, though it may allow slight seepage

Shrinkage cracks are virtually unavoidable in concrete floors. They form as water evaporates from the concrete mix during curing, causing a slight contraction of the material.

2. Settlement Cracks

These more concerning cracks result from soil activity under the slab:

  • Appearance: Often wider than 1/8 inch, may show vertical displacement
  • Cause: Soil consolidation or washout beneath the floor
  • Concern level: Moderate to high, depending on severity
  • Progression: Typically worsens over time without intervention
  • Water risk: Significant, often allows substantial water intrusion

Settlement cracks occur when the soil supporting your basement floor compacts or erodes. This can happen due to poor soil preparation before construction, natural soil consolidation over time, or water washing away soil beneath the slab.

3. Frost Heave Cracks

In colder regions, these cracks result from freezing soil:

  • Appearance: Often accompanied by floor sections that rise during winter
  • Cause: Freezing of moisture in the soil beneath the slab
  • Concern level: Moderate to high
  • Progression: May worsen each freeze-thaw cycle
  • Water risk: Significant during thaw periods

Frost heave happens when water in the soil under your basement freezes and expands. This pushes sections of your floor upward, creating cracks and uneven surfaces that often worsen with each freeze-thaw cycle.

4. Structural Pressure Cracks

These serious cracks indicate significant foundation stress:

  • Appearance: Often wide, with noticeable displacement or multiple parallel patterns
  • Cause: Lateral pressure from soil, water, or foundation movement
  • Concern level: High, indicates potential structural issues
  • Progression: Typically worsens without professional intervention
  • Water risk: Substantial, often associated with ongoing water intrusion

Structural pressure cracks suggest forces are actively working against your foundation,” warns a structural engineer. “These require prompt professional evaluation as they often indicate problems that will continue to worsen and may eventually compromise your home’s structural integrity.”

5. Slab Curl Cracks

These distinctive cracks form near walls and columns:

  • Appearance: Typically parallel to walls or around columns, often with edges curling upward
  • Cause: Differential drying of concrete during curing
  • Concern level: Low to moderate
  • Progression: Usually stabilizes after initial formation
  • Water risk: Moderate, may allow seepage at wall-floor joints

“Slab curl occurs when the top of the concrete parches faster than the base during curing,” explains a concrete specialist. “This causes the edges to curl slightly upward, creating stress that results in cracks typically running parallel to walls or around columns.”

Warning Signs That Basement Floor Cracks Are Worsening

Monitoring basement floor cracks helps identify when professional intervention is needed:

Progressive Changes

Several indicators suggest cracks are actively worsening:

  • Increasing width: Cracks that grow wider over time
  • Developing displacement: Edges becoming uneven where they were once level
  • Lengthening cracks: Cracks that extend into new areas
  • Branching patterns: New cracks developing off existing ones
  • Seasonal activity: Cracks that open and are packed with seasonal changes

Water Intrusion Signs

Moisture associated with cracks indicates water problems:

  • Visible dampness: Consistently wet areas along cracks
  • Efflorescence: White mineral deposits left as water evaporates
  • Mold growth: Fungal development near or along cracks
  • Water staining: Discoloration extending from cracks
  • Increased humidity: General dampness in the basement environment

Structural Impact Indicators

Signs that floor cracks are affecting the broader structure:

  • Wall cracks: New or widening cracks in foundation walls
  • Uneven floors: Sloping or dipping of the basement floor
  • Stuck doors or windows: Opening issues on the first floor above problem areas
  • Separation of walls from floors or ceilings: Gaps developing at these junctions
  • Visual foundation movement: Shifting or settling visible from external inspection

The Risks of Ignoring Basement Floor Cracks

Understanding the potential consequences of delaying repairs helps prioritize appropriate action:

Progressive Structural Damage

Untreated cracks often lead to escalating structural issues:

  • Worsening foundation settlement: Continued sinking or shifting of the foundation
  • Compromised load-bearing capacity: Less structural support for your home
  • Wall failure risk: Increased pressure on foundation walls
  • Floor slab deterioration: Accelerated breakdown of concrete integrity
  • Support column issues: Potential undermining of basement columns

Water Damage and Moisture Problems

Cracks provide ways for water to penetrate your basement:

  • Persistent dampness: Ongoing moisture issues in the basement
  • Mold and mildew growth: Health hazards from fungal development
  • Damaged belongings: Items stored in the basement suffering water damage
  • Increased humidity: Moisture affecting the entire home environment
  • Insect attraction: Damp conditions drawing pests into your home

Property Value Impact

Unaddressed foundation issues significantly affect home value:

  • Failed home inspections: Problems identified during the sales process
  • Reduced market value: Discounted pricing to account for needed repairs
  • Limited customer pool: Many buyers immediately reject homes with foundation issues
  • Financing obstacles: Lender requirements for repairs before closing
  • Disclosure requirements: Legal obligation to disclose known problems

Increased Repair Costs

Postponing repairs typically leads to more extensive and costly solutions:

  • Expanding damage scope: Problems affecting more of the structure over time
  • More invasive repairs: Requiring greater disruption to your home
  • Higher material costs: Larger areas needing attention
  • Extended labour requirements: More time-intensive repair processes
  • Additional restoration needs: Addressing secondary damage to finishes and systems

DIY Assessment: When to Call a Foundation Repair Professional

While some monitoring can be done yourself, knowing when to seek expert help is crucial:

Self-Monitoring Steps

Homeowners can take these steps to assess basement floor cracks:

  • Measure crack width: Use a ruler or crack gauge to document size
  • Mark crack ends: Note where cracks terminate to track any lengthening
  • Photograph regularly: Take dated pictures for comparison over time
  • Check for moisture: Monitor for dampness after rain events
  • Look for displacement: Place a straight edge across cracks to check for unevenness

Professional Assessment Triggers

Several situations warrant immediate professional evaluation:

  • Cracks wider than 1/8 inch suggest significant movement
  • Any vertical displacement: Where one side of the crack is higher than the other
  • Cracks that extend into walls: Indicating whole-foundation issues
  • Multiple parallel cracks: Suggesting systematic foundation problems
  • Progressive widening: Cracks that are actively growing
  • Consistent moisture: Ongoing water intrusion through cracks

What to Expect from a Professional Evaluation

A thorough foundation assessment typically includes the following:

  • Visual inspection: Comprehensive examination of all foundation elements
  • Moisture testing: Checking for water intrusion and humidity issues
  • Structural evaluation: Assessing overall foundation condition
  • Measurement and documentation: Precise recording of crack characteristics
  • Cause determination: Identifying the underlying issues creating the cracks

“A qualified foundation repair specialist will look beyond just the cracks themselves to identify root causes,” explains Davis. “This comprehensive approach ensures that repairs address the source of the problem, not just its symptoms.”
